Accessing Your Watch History

The primary location for reviewing your past activity is the Watch History menu. This log automatically records every video you play, provided your account is signed in and history is not manually disabled. It serves as a chronological archive of your YouTube sessions, making it the first place to look when trying to find something you recently viewed.

Desktop Browser Steps

On a computer, accessing history is straightforward and requires just a few clicks. You do not need to download any third-party tools, as YouTube provides a robust interface directly within your account dashboard. Follow these steps to pull up the full list of videos you have watched.

Sign in to your Google account on youtube.com.

Click your profile picture in the top right corner.

Select "History" from the dropdown menu.

Use the search box at the top of the History page to filter by keyword, channel name, or video title.

Mobile App Navigation

Mobile users access the same history database through the app interface. The layout is slightly different, but the functionality is identical, allowing you to search and manage your past views from your phone or tablet. This is particularly useful for picking up where you left off during commutes or breaks.

Open the YouTube app and tap your profile icon.

Tap "History" near the top of the menu.

Use the search bar at the top of the screen to enter keywords.

Tap the "X" next to individual items to remove them from your history.

Managing Privacy and Deletion

Your history is a sensitive record of your interests and habits. YouTube gives you full control to delete specific entries or pause the recording entirely. If you are sharing a device or simply wish to clean up your digital footprint, the management tools are easy to locate and use.

To delete a single video, click the three dots next to the entry and select "Remove from Watch history." To erase everything, choose "Clear all watch history." If you want to stop future tracking temporarily, select "Pause watch history" until you are ready to resume logging.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Occasionally, users encounter issues where the search bar returns no results or the history does not load. This is usually due to account settings or technical glitches rather than a data loss. Checking your privacy settings is the first step to resolving these anomalies.
